AMENDED AND RESTATED CREDIT AGREEMENT
THIS AMENDED AND RESTATED CREDIT AGREEMENT dated as of March 23, 2005, among HILTON HOTELS CORPORATION (“Borrower”), the Lenders who are parties hereto from time to time, BANK OF AMERICA, N.A., as Administrative Agent, THE BANK OF NEW YORK, as Syndication Agent, BNP PARIBAS, THE ROYAL BANK OF SCOTLAND PLC and WACHOVIA BANK, NATIONAL ASSOCIATION, as Co-Documentation Agents and THE BANK OF NOVA SCOTIA, CALYON NEW YORK BRANCH and XXXXX FARGO BANK, NATIONAL ASSOCIATION, as the Senior Managing Agents. The parties hereto agree with reference to the following facts:
A. Pursuant to a Five Year Credit Agreement dated as of August 29, 2003 among Borrower, certain of the Lenders, and Bank of America, N.A., as Administrative Agent, a credit facility has been provided to the Borrower by certain of the Lenders (as amended, the “Existing Credit Facility”).
B. Borrower has requested an extension of the term of the Existing Credit Facility, and certain other amendments thereto as set forth herein.
C. Concurrently with the execution hereof, certain of the lenders under the Existing Credit Facility will terminate their status as Lenders and certain new Lenders signatory hereto will be admitted.
NOW, THEREFORE, the parties hereto hereby represent, warrant, covenant and agree as follows:

1.02 Accounting Terms and Determinations. Unless otherwise specified herein, all accounting terms used herein shall be interpreted, all accounting determinations hereunder shall be made, and all financial statements required to be delivered hereunder shall be prepared, in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les as in effect from time to time, applied on a basis consistent (except for changes concurred in by the Borrower’s independent public accountants and disclosed in such financial statements) with the most recent audited consolidated financial statements of the Borrower and its Subsidiaries delivered to the Lenders; provided that, if the Borrower notifies the Administrative Agent
15
that the Borrower wishes to amend any covenant in Article V to eliminate the effect of any change in generally accepted accounting principles on the operation of such covenant (or if the Administrative Agent notifies the Borrower that the Required Lenders wish to amend Article V for such purpose), then the Borrower’s compliance with such covenant shall be determined on the basis of generally accepted accounting principles in effect immediately before the relevant change in generally accepted accounting principles became effective, until either such notice is withdrawn or such covenant is amended in a manner satisfactory to the Borrower and the Required Lenders.
1.03 Types of Borrowings. Borrowings are classified for purposes of this Agreement either by reference to the pricing of Loans comprising such Borrowing (e.g., a “Euro-Dollar Borrowing” is a Borrowing comprised of Euro-Dollar Loans) or by reference to the provisions of Article II under which participation therein is determined.
1.04 Letter of Credit Amounts. Unless otherwise specified herein, the amount of a Letter of Credit at any time shall be deemed to be the stated amount of such Letter of Credit in effect at such time; provided, however, that with respect to any Letter of Credit that, by its terms or the terms of any Issuer Document related thereto, provides for one or more automatic increases in the stated amount thereof, the amount of such Letter of Credit shall be deemed to be the maximum stated amount of such Letter of Credit after giving effect to all such increases, whether or not such maximum stated amount is in effect at such time.
16
2.01 Commitments to Lend. During the Revolving Credit Period each Lender severally agrees, on the terms and conditions set forth in this Agreement, to lend to the Borrower pursuant to this Section from time to time amounts such that (a) the aggregate outstanding principal amount of Committed Loans made by such Lender plus such Lender’s Pro Rata Share of the aggregate outstanding principal amount of all Swing Line Outstandings plus such Lender’s Pro Rata Share of all Letter of Credit Liabilities shall not exceed the amount of such Lender’s Commitment, and (b) the aggregate outstanding principal amount of all Committed Loans and Swing Line Loans plus the Letter of Credit Liabilities shall not exceed the aggregate Commitments. Each Borrowing under this Section shall be in an aggregate principal amount of $10,000,000 or any larger multiple of $1,000,000; and each Borrowing shall be made from the several Lenders ratably in proportion to their respective Commitments. Within the foregoing limits, the Borrower may borrow under this Section, repay, or to the extent permitted by Section 2.15, prepay Loans and reborrow under this Section. The Committed Loans shall mature, and the principal amount thereof shall be due and payable, on the Termination Date.

2.07 Interest Rates. (a) Each Base Rate Loan shall bear interest on the outstanding principal amount thereof, for each day from (and including) the date such Loan is made to (but excluding) the date it becomes due, at a rate per annum equal to the Base Rate for such day plus any applicable Base Rate Margin. Any overdue principal of or interest on any Base Rate Loan shall, at the option of the Required Lenders, bear interest, payable on demand, for each day until paid at a rate per annum equal to the Base Rate plus the Base Rate Margin plus 2%. Such interest shall be payable on the last Domestic Business Day of each calendar quarter in arrears and on the Termination Date.
(b) Each Euro-Dollar Loan shall bear interest on the outstanding principal amount thereof, for each day during the Interest Period applicable thereto (from and including the first day of such Interest Period to but excluding the last day of such Interest Period), at a rate per annum equal to the sum of (a) the Euro-Dollar Margin for such day plus (b) the applicable Euro-Dollar Rate for such Interest Period. Such interest shall be payable for each Interest Period on the last day thereof and, if such Interest Period is longer than three months, at intervals of three months after the first day thereof.
(c) Any overdue principal of or interest on any Euro-Dollar Loan shall, at the option of the Required Lenders, bear interest, payable on demand, for each day until paid at a rate per annum equal to the sum of 2% plus the Euro-Dollar Margin for such day plus the Eurodollar Rate for one day deposits in Dollars in an amount approximately equal to such overdue payment (or, if the circumstances described
21
in clause (a) or (b) of Section 8.01 shall exist, at a rate per annum equal to the sum of 2% plus the rate applicable to Base Rate Loans for such day).
(d) Swing Line Loans shall bear interest at a fluctuating rate per annum equal to the Base Rate plus any applicable Base Rate Margin. Interest on the Swing Line Loans shall be payable on such dates, not more frequent than monthly, as may be specified by the Swing Line Lender and in any event on the Termination Date. Any overdue principal of or interest on any Swing Line Loan shall bear interest, payable on demand, for each day until paid at a rate per annum equal to the sum of the Base Rate plus any applicable Base Rate Margin plus 2% per annum for such day.
(e) The Administrative Agent shall determine in accordance with the provisions of this Agreement each interest rate applicable to the Loans hereunder. The Administrative Agent shall give prompt notice to the Borrower and the participating Lenders of each rate of interest so determined, and its determination thereof shall be conclusive in the absence of manifest error.

2.23 Extension of Termination Date. The Termination Date may be extended once in each year, in the manner set forth in this Section, effective on June 30, 2006, and on each anniversary of such date which falls not less than one year prior to the Termination Date (as theretofore extended) for a period of one year after the date on which the Termination Date would otherwise have occurred. If the Borrower wishes to extend the Termination Date, it shall give written notice to that effect to the Administrative Agent not more than 60 days following the delivery to the Administrative Agent of the audited annual financial statements of Borrower in accordance with Section 5.01(a), whereupon the Administrative Agent shall notify each of the Lenders of such notice. Each Lender will respond to such request, whether affirmatively or negatively, within 30 days (the “Response Date”). If a Lender or Lenders respond negatively or fail to timely respond to such request, but such non-extending Lender(s) have Commitment(s) aggregating less than 33 1/3% of the aggregate amount of the Commitments, the Borrower shall, for a period of up to 60 days following the Response Date (but in any event not later than 15 days prior to the then effective Termination Date), have the right, with the assistance of the Administrative Agent, to seek a mutually satisfactory substitute financial institution or financial institutions (which may be one or more of the Lenders) to assume the Commitment(s) of such non-extending Lender(s). No Lender which fails to consent shall be deemed to have consented to a request by the Borrower under this Section. Not later than the third Domestic Business Day prior to the end of such period (whether of 60 days or shorter), the Borrower shall, by notice to the Lenders through the Administrative Agent, either (i) terminate, effective on the third Domestic Business Day after the giving of such notice, the Commitment(s) of such non-extending Lender(s), whereupon the Lenders who have consented to the extension shall continue with their commitments unaffected to lend subject to the terms of this Agreement to the new Termination Date, or (ii) designate one or more new financial institutions reasonably acceptable to the Administrative Agent to assume the Commitments of such non-extending Lenders, whereupon the aggregate amount of such Commitment(s) shall be assumed by such substitute financial institution or financial institutions within such 60-day period or (iii) withdraw its request for an extension of the Termination Date, in which case the Commitments shall continue unaffected. The failure of the Borrower to timely take the actions contemplated by clause (i) or (ii) of the preceding sentence shall be deemed a withdrawal of its request for an extension as contemplated by clause (ii) whether or not notice to such effect is given. So long as Lenders having Commitment(s) totaling not less than 66 2/3% of the aggregate amount of the Commitment(s) shall have responded affirmatively to such a request, and such request is not withdrawn in accordance with the preceding sentence, then, subject to receipt by the Administrative Agent of counterparts of an Extension Agreement in substantially the form of Exhibit G duly completed and signed by all of the parties hereto (other than non-consenting Lenders), the Termination Date shall be extended for the period set forth in this Section 2.23 and in the Extension Agreement.

5.06 Negative Pledge. None of the Borrower, any Covered Subsidiary or any Significant Subsidiary will create, incur (or permit to incur) or assume any Lien on any asset now owned or hereafter acquired by it, except:
(a) Liens existing as of the Effective Date;
(b) any Lien existing on any asset of any Person at the time such Person becomes a Subsidiary of the Borrower or at the time such Person is merged or consolidated with or into the Borrower or a Subsidiary of the Borrower, in each case where the Lien is not created in contemplation of such event;
(c) any Lien on any asset securing Debt incurred or assumed for the purpose of financing all or any part of the cost of acquiring or constructing such asset (it being understood that, for this purpose, the acquisition of a Person is also an acquisition of the assets of such Person); provided that the Lien attaches to such asset concurrently with or within 180 days after the acquisition thereof, or such longer period, not to exceed 12 months, due to the Borrower’s inability to retain the requisite governmental approvals with respect to such acquisition; provided further that, in the case of real estate, (i) the Lien attaches within 12 months after the latest of the acquisition thereof, the completion of construction thereon or the commencement of full operation thereof and (ii) the Debt so secured does not exceed the sum of (x) the purchase price of such real estate plus (y) the costs of such construction;
(d) any Lien existing on any asset prior to the acquisition thereof by the Borrower or a Subsidiary of the Borrower and not created in contemplation of such acquisition;
(e) any Lien arising out of the refinancing, extension, renewal or refunding of any Debt secured by any Lien permitted by any of the foregoing clauses of this Section, provided that such Debt is not increased (other than to cover any transaction costs of such refinancing, extension, renewal or refunding) and is not secured by any additional assets;
(f) Liens arising in the ordinary course of its business which (i) do not secure Debt, (ii) do not secure any single obligation in an amount exceeding $50,000,000 and
42
(iii) do not in the aggregate materially detract from the value of its assets or materially impair the use thereof in the operation of its business;
(g) Liens securing Debt of a Subsidiary of the Borrower to the Borrower or another Subsidiary of the Borrower; and
(h) Liens not otherwise permitted by the foregoing clauses of this Section encumbering assets of the Borrower and its Subsidiaries having an aggregate fair market value which is not in excess of 10% of Consolidated Net Tangible Assets (determined, in each case, by reference to the most recent date prior to the incurrence or assumption of such Lien for which Borrower has delivered its financial statements under Section 5.01(a) or Section 5.01(b), as applicable).
5.07 Consolidations, Mergers and Sales of Assets. The Borrower will not (i) consolidate or merge with or into any other Person or (ii) sell, lease or otherwise transfer all or any substantial part of the assets of the Borrower and its Subsidiaries, taken as a whole, to any other Person; provided that, the Borrower may merge with another Person if (A) the Borrower is the corporation surviving such merger and (B) immediately after giving effect to such merger, no Default shall have occurred and be continuing.
5.08 Use of Proceeds. The proceeds of the Loans made under this Agreement will be used by the Borrower and its Subsidiaries for general corporate purposes. None of such proceeds will be used, directly or indirectly, for the purpose, whether immediate, incidental or ultimate, of buying or carrying any “margin stock” within the meaning of Regulation U in any manner that would violate Regulation X or result in a violation of Regulation U.
